Four Trends in Eastern European Cybercrime

Four trends in Eastern European cybercrime defy conventional wisdom, cybersecurity expert says. Ransomware has become the No. 1 scourge on the Internet, particularly after WannaCry. Russia won’t turn over suspects related to U.S. cybercrime investigations. There’s almost no cooperation between U.K. and Russian law enforcement on cybercrime. Some Russian-speaking hacking forums are having adult conversations about what ransomware is doing for the cybercrime community and how they should react to it, expert Tim Bobak says.”]
